Default gearbox oil / turret oil

hey guys, so id like to change out the oil in the turret and gearbox.(also have to replace the shift boots) i have a 1990 NA, and i was just curious as to whats the best oil for said turret and gearbox. any suggestions? thanks

I'm using 1 quart off the shelf synthetic Valvoline and one quart Redline shockproof. The five speed shifts much better than it used to. The 3rd gear synchros used to complain before the shockproof was added.
